原文:Flink&Blink【編程模型、核心概念、SQL代碼實戰】

一.Flink新特性 .支持Scala . .對SQL功能進行完善 a.Streaming SQL新增Temporal Tables 時態表 時態表:時態表記錄了數據改變的歷史狀態,該表可以返回特定時間點的表的內容。 b.Streaming SQL支持模式匹配 模式匹配:Flink CEP是Flink的復雜事件處理庫。它允許在流上定義一系列的模式,最終使得可以方便的抽取自己需要的重要事件。 c.S ...

2020-02-29 17:58 0 2613 推薦指數:

查看詳情

Flink SQL 核心概念剖析與編程案例實戰

本次,我們從 0 開始逐步剖析 Flink SQL 的來龍去脈以及核心概念,並附帶完整的示例程序,希望對大家有幫助! 本文大綱 一、快速體驗 Flink SQL 為了快速搭建環境體驗 Flink SQL,我們使用 Docker 來安裝一些基礎組件,包括 zk 和 kafka,如果你有這 ...

Fri Jan 08 17:32:00 CST 2021 0 818
Flink項目實戰(一)---核心概念及基本使用

前言、flink介紹:   Apache Flink 是一個分布式處理引擎,用於在無界和有界數據流上進行有狀態的計算。通過對時間精確控制以及狀態化控制,Flink能夠運行在任何處理無界流的應用中,同時對有界流,則由一些專為固定數據集設計的算法和數據結構進行了內部處理,從而提升了性能 ...

Tue Aug 24 06:09:00 CST 2021 0 323
Flink實戰(六) - Table API & SQL編程

1 意義 1.1 分層的 APIs & 抽象層次 Flink提供三層API。 每個API在簡潔性和表達性之間提供不同的權衡,並針對不同的用例。 而且Flink提供不同級別的抽象來開發流/批處理應用程序 最低級抽象只提供有狀態流。它通過Process Function ...

Mon Jul 22 06:38:00 CST 2019 4 432
Flink入門(四)——編程模型

flink是一款開源的大數據流式處理框架,他可以同時批處理和流處理,具有容錯性、高吞吐、低延遲等優勢,本文簡述flink編程模型。 數據集類型: 無窮數據集:無窮的持續集成的數據集合 有界數據集:有限不會改變的數據集合 常見的無窮數據集有: 用戶與客戶端的實時交互 ...

Mon Dec 16 19:00:00 CST 2019 0 307
Flink學習(十三) Flink 常見核心概念分析

分布式緩存熟悉 Hadoop 的你應該知道,分布式緩存最初的思想誕生於 Hadoop 框架,Hadoop 會將一些數據或者文件緩存在 HDFS 上,在分布式環境中讓所有的計算節點調用同一個配置文件。在 Flink 中,Flink 框架開發者們同樣將這個特性進行了實現。 Flink 提供的分布式 ...

Thu May 21 04:02:00 CST 2020 0 796
Flink實戰(七) - Time & Windows編程

0 相關源碼 掌握Flink中三種常用的Time處理方式,掌握Flink中滾動窗口以及滑動窗口的使用,了解Flink中的watermark。 Flink 在流處理工程中支持不同的時間概念。 1 處理時間(Processing time) 執行相應算子操作的機器的系統時間. 當流程序在處理 ...

Tue Jul 23 20:18:00 CST 2019 0 467
Flink學習(八) Flink SQL & Table 編程和案例

Flink Table & SQL 概述背景我們在前面的課時中講過 Flink 的分層模型Flink 自身提供了不同級別的抽象來支持我們開發流式或者批量處理程序,下圖描述了 Flink 支持的 4 種不同級別的抽象。 Table API 和 SQL 處於最頂端,是 Flink ...

Sun May 17 00:51:00 CST 2020 0 3358
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M